Intercept Activity

The Intercept Activity (INTA) page serves as the data source for Internal Intercept and Federal Payment Offset activity reporting including intercept activity associated with a payment provided in a particular Check Writer file, and Federal Payment Offset activity associated with the Federal payments offset by State debts. The INTA page allows you to view transaction detail information on payment offset activity for each individual claim.

For Internal Intercept Activity, reference data is maintained on this page, and is updated by the Automated Disbursement and Disbursement Intercept process. All fields on this table, except Cleared, are system-maintained. The Cleared field is used to indicate that the item has been reconciled, that is, the cash has been physically transferred to the correct bank account. However, Check Writer disbursement transactions are not “true transactions”, therefore any links to these transactions will not work.

For Federal Payment Offset activity, the Federal Offset Information section stores and displays the Federal Payment Offset information and payment details.  The information in this section is mainly populated based on the transfer transactions and Federal Offset Activity (FOTA) table.

The Reversal Information section is populated by the submission of the ITO/GAOP transactions that are used to process Federal Payment Offset reversals.

The Offset Fee section is populated by the Generate Federal Offset Payment to Entities batch process.
